Our client is a D2C business based in the West Midlands who are currently recruiting an E-commerce & Digital Manager to take clear ownership of day-to-day DTC performance.
You will report to the Director and work closely with the leadership, brand and operations teams.
This is an exciting opportunity to join the business at a time of high growth. We are looking for someone who can:
- Proactively find and acquire customers in a low‑volume, early‑stage context
- Turn performance data into clear actions and priorities
- Run consistent weekly trading and testing
- Own conversion, funnel performance and the on‑site experience
- Make paid media and email work together as joined‑up acquisition and conversion channels
- Learn from performance and develop an effective multi‑channel digital marketing strategy
ACCOUNTABILITIES Trading & Performance (DTC Trading)
- Run weekly DTC trading: review KPIs, spot issues, set priorities, deliver actions.
- Turn performance data into clear commercial decisions.
- Monitor traffic, conversion rate (CVR), CAC/ROAS, AOV and repeat purchase.
- Own Shopify site performance and conversion rate optimisation (CRO).
- Identify drop‑offs across UX, trust, messaging and checkout funnel.
- Deliver quick, high‑impact improvements using Shopify apps, heatmaps and on‑site feedback.
- Hands‑on management of paid social and paid search (Meta Ads, Google Ads or similar).
- Build, launch and optimise campaigns within agreed budgets (not an oversight‑only role).
- Test audiences, creatives, offers and messaging with a structured test‑and‑learn approach.
- Own email marketing and lifecycle/CRM activity.
- Build and optimise automated flows: welcome, browse abandon, cart abandon etc.
- Improve segmentation, cadence, deliverability and performance.
